Fixes beam runtimes
Created by: BarneyGumball
Sanity checks and removing the unnecessary damage application on beam disconnect for blobs. The blob piece would try to delete itself twice resulting in runtimes if it was destroyed with a beam attached.
Fixes #12336 (closed)
- bugfix: Fixed emitters bugging out on blobs.